It's beginning to look a lot like Christmas in Harrow after the switching on of the seasonal lights.

Organised by the Harrow Business Improvement District (BID), this year's event proved a big hit with the thousands of people who attended on Saturday.

Andy Stubbs, chief executive at Harrow BID said: "It was a joy to see so many beaming faces in the town centre. I would like to personally thank everyone who came to take part in the festivities, you really made the event what it was and certainly helped us spread some Christmas spirit.

"A lot of hard work went into organising the day so I am delighted to see that it was such a success.”

Miles Otway from Radio Harrow performed throughout the day on the stage situated on St Anns Road.

There was also entertainment from Harrow Philharmonic Choir, Harrow based dance crew, Kidology, plus, dancers from Karan's Bollywood Masterclass.

Many also enjoyed a free visit to Santa’s grotto on the day where they were greeted by Harrow’s very own cheeky elf and went away with a special Christmas gift.

The BID was formed in 2014 following a vote by town centre businesses.
